    How to make iced coffee at home

    When the weather gets hot, 221878 nothing is more refreshing than a glass cold iced coffee. If you don't wish to pay for a cup of coffee or wait for it to be made at a cafe or restaurant, you can make your own. And it's not just cheaper however, you can also customize the recipe to suit your preferences.

    Here's how you can make a cup of costa iced coffee at home:

    Fill a glass or jar with ice and add coffee liquid. Mix and serve. If you'd like to, top with milk or sugar to taste.

    Costa's Signature Blend is a blend of arabica and robusta beans, which is perfect for making milky coffees. Robusta is typically harsher than arabica, however when blended in the right proportions it can give an incredibly smooth flavor. To get the best taste you should purchase your beans fresh.

    If you don't own a milk frother then you can try adding some ice cubes. This will cool the coffee without altering the taste. If you prefer a stronger coffee, you can make coffee icecubes you have created by pouring leftovers into an ice-cube tray, and then freezing them for a night. Add a scoop vanilla ice-cream to the coffee floating.

    The secret to a successful cup of iced coffee is the ratio of coffee to water. It is recommended to use less water than normal when brewing coffee. Let the rest cool. You can allow it to sit at room temperature or speed up the process by placing it in the fridge.

    After the coffee has reached the temperature of room temperature, strain it through a fine mesh sieve to get rid of any coffee ground. The brewed coffee can be stored in a jar or bottle and kept in the refrigerator for up to a week. If you'd like to serve it hot, simply warm it in the microwave for about a minute or two.

    You can use honey or maple syrup in place of sugar to make this drink more sweet. You can also add a bit of cocoa powder to give it a chocolate-y taste. Peppermint extract is a wonderful option if you enjoy mint. Or, if you'd like to enjoy your iced beverage with a little crunch, add a handful of coconut shavings or 221878 toasting nuts.

    How do you make a mocha latte?

    The first step is heating up the milk. You can utilize a steamer or heat the milk for 30 seconds in the microwave. Then, whisk it until bubbles begin to form. This will result in a foamy texture that is similar to the one you'd get in a cafe. Pour the milk over the espresso or coffee. If you want, top the mocha with whip cream. You can also add chocolate shavings or cocoa powder to give your mocha a little more flavor.

    How to make cappuccino

    The cappuccino combines espresso and steamed, foamed milk. The cappuccino is usually topped with cinnamon or chocolate. The drink is very popular in the UK, and it is simple to make at home. It is important to prepare the milk in a proper manner to avoid lumps in your drink. To make this happen you need to heat the milk in a saucepan until it is warm but not boiling. Then employ a whisk to stir the milk until it is smooth and frothy.
